/* Returns the total amount of physical memory.
|
|
This value is more or less a hard limit for the working set. */
|
|
double physmem_total (void);
|
|
|
|
/* Returns the amount of physical memory available.
|
|
This value is the amount of memory the application can use without hindering
|
|
any other process (assuming that no other process increases its memory
|
|
usage). */
|
|
double physmem_available (void);
|
|
|
|
/* Returns the amount of physical memory that can be claimed, with a given
|
|
aggressivity.
|
|
For AGGRESSIVITY == 0.0, the result is like physmem_available (): the amount
|
|
of memory the application can use without hindering any other process.
|
|
For AGGRESSIVITY == 1.0, the result is the amount of memory the application
|
|
can use, while causing memory shortage to other processes, but without
|
|
bringing the machine into an out-of-memory state.
|
|
Values in between, for example AGGRESSIVITY == 0.5, are a reasonable middle
|
|
ground. */
|
|
double physmem_claimable (double aggressivity);
